A world of his own: Arthur Russell
This month’s episode of Polypunk focuses on the work of Arthur Russell.
Cover photography by Nick Currie.
It is hard to summarize Russell’s work in one hour, as his output ranges from disco tracks to Dylan-esque folk and instrumental pieces. Wild combination, the documentary directed by Matt Wolf makes a good introduction, as does the World of Arthur Russell compilation. The 1986 album World of echo is highly recommended. Russell passed away in 1992 and left us with a highly emotional work that will continue to inspire. Relevant, moving, powerful: great art indeed.
